As birth rates are plummeting and many women are left childless in Japan, a synthetic baby companion called Kirobo Mini is design here by Toyota Motor Corp. This is a robot of hardly of palm size.
 
The demographic trend in Japan has put the nation in the forefront of aging among the other industrial nations. This results in contraction in population
 
The robot slightly wobbles just to emulate a seated baby that has not got the ability to balance itself yet, said the chief design engineer of Kirobo Mini, Fuminori Ketaoka. It is targeted to create an emotional connect.
 
The robot will also blink its eyes and speak in high pitched voice just like a typical baby. It will be sold from next year for Rs 39,800 ($392). A cradle also comes with it and this can also be used as a baby seat. This is as small that it can even get fit in car cup holders.
 
This new creation by Toyota joins the list of companion robots like the Jibo by Massachusetts Institute of Technology that is similar to swiveling lamp, Paro which is a robot baby seal from Japanese marketer used for therapeutic machine for elderly dementia sufferers.
